Transaction cca17f927445765cac6255254a4141c7e2602263debe19203e5a975883564867
1 Input
1 Output
-
cca17f927445765cac6255254a4141c7e2602263debe19203e5a975883564867:0
- value
- 127933
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 776c0b1a38f0e9cd61b0fa57ca3517a4d52d0d05 OP_EQUAL
- address
- 3CaTmMdMC4eQNrqVeXnKLhExjwS1UHVBVK